Public °ewe,., Hearing Draft <br />Case Study: Neptune Drive Shoreline Flood Protection <br />The City of San Leandro has proposed forming an assessment district to fund the <br />construction of a levee at 13145-13164 Neptune Drive near the intersection of Neptune <br />Drive and Marina Boulevard. The levee would be one of two levees designed to <br />provide flood protection and reduce the number of properties that fall within the flood <br />zone. <br />Several hundred properties fall within the FEMA-designated "High Risk" Flood Zone, <br />including several that were added in 2016. When both levees are completed, the FEMA <br />Flood Zone designation will change from "High Risk" to "Moderate to Low Risk," helping <br />to protect community members from flooding and SLR and potentially reducing flood <br />insurance premiums. <br />The site of the proposed levee, circled in yellow. <br />Page 48 San Leandro 2021 Climate Action Plan <br />
